Fremantle star Harley Bennell could again be in hot water after it was alleged he was involved in an altercation in a Fremantle nightclub on Sunday night. 

Video footage obtained by Channel Seven show a man involved in a scuffle with security guards inside Club 189 in Fremantle, with bystanders claiming the man involved was the AFL midfielder. 

In a statement released by the football club, Fremantle officials declared they are aware of "a matter involving a player at a licensed premises."

"The club is making enquiries and will be in a position to comment further when that process is completed," the statement read.

The allegations could put Bennell's AFL future under a cloud as he is no stranger to off-field controversy, having previously been reprimanded for an alcohol-fuelled incident on the Gold Coast along with photos emerging of Bennell with a white powder, alleged to be illicit drugs among a long list of indiscretions. 

To make matters worse for Bennell, he then failed to attend training on Monday morning, Fremantle's first since the Christmas break.
